你查询的IP:[116.4.127.189]  地理位置:中国–广东–东莞

最新查询59.107.17.222 118.239.51.58 114.68.34.101 121.51.221.21 61.28.154.161 121.4.248.133 125.64.93.229 118.64.20.184 123.103.91.63 116.4.127.189 118.224.45.67 203.196.166.252 202.4.252.185 121.58.101.96 118.88.32.206 116.242.163.150 203.95.96.193 124.31.149.236 121.56.136.20 121.100.128.95 58.87.64.3 123.196.169.249 121.55.169.219 121.40.83.40 124.156.213.137 124.40.128.70 202.38.85.210 203.212.80.234 202.136.208.130 202.69.16.85 119.18.224.159